If you use a TA or RCI directly you have a better chance of getting the same cabin for both legs of the B2B as they can see availability for both legs and suggest cabins that are available on both. 1 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

suesnake2002 Posted January 19, 2020 #9 Share Posted January 19, 2020 I have a Ta book my cruise. But when it comes to rooms, I like to pick em myself. First I decide catagory, then decks. And make a list of all cabins available on both cruises. Then i call TA to book with rooms in preference order. icsys Posted January 28, 2020 #13 Share Posted January 28, 2020 We also booked a B2B on Freedom for September 2020 with RCI over the phone. This will be our first ever B2B so we may have questions. We only paid one deposit for both cruises. Each cruise is on a separate invoice with its own reservation ID. Cruise 1 invoice shows total charge for cruise 1 and balance due less deposit paid. Cruise 2 invoice shows total charge for both cruises and balance due for cruise 2. From the above I assumed the cruises would be linked but we just had the GTY cabins assigned and the 2nd week cabin is three doors down the corridor from the 1st week. (very close to that's good) Crazy that they would assign different cabins, especially seeing as the one assigned on cruise 2 is available to book right now on cruise 1, meaning more work for the steward on turnaround day moving all our belongings. Having said that, at least the 'new' cabin will be clean and fresh for the second week.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
